## PR: Stable sorts in Quartermill report builder

Heads up, on-call: some grouped reports were reshuffling rows between refreshes because we used an unstable sort on tied keys. This swaps in a stable sort plus a deterministic tiebreaker, so exports stop flip-flopping. Perf hit is tiny but real on huge reports, hence the new caps and batch sizes. The tuning constants introduced here are listed below.

constants for tageg-kagag:
QUOTAS = {
    "kelax": 495,
    "istath": 366,
    "tammir": 108,
    "novdor": 730,
    "casax": 816,
    "quenael": 874,
    "pelius": 403,
}

Spoolpike runbook — restart procedure. If jobs stall, drain the queue first: spoolctl drain --grace 30. Never kill the worker mid-render; partial pages corrupt the tray state in Printhaven firmware. After drain, clear /var/spoolpike/tmp and restart the unit. The service reads its env file at boot only, so edits require a full restart. It authenticates to the render farm on startup, and the env file must end with the line that sets that credential.

secret setting of yajog-taguf: ARCHIVE_KEY3=051

### Bulk edits in the Wardroom admin table

Bulk edits apply up to 500 rows per action. Every change writes an immutable audit row with actor, timestamp, and diff. Only the `ops-editor` role may invoke bulk mode. Audit rows live in a separate schema. To verify audit integrity, query that schema directly via the connection string below.

primary connection of yagep-kahip = redis://giliel_svc:zYiKsLL2PLpfPL@db-348f.xolmarsys.corp:5432/fenwyn